Understanding Learning Loss:

Learning loss is the decline of academic skills and knowledge students lose when they are not subjected to structured learning for a substantial period, typically during school breaks. 

This occurs most notably during long vacations, such as summer breaks, and is often called the “summer slide.” Because students do not continuously apply themselves to school materials during such breaks, the skills they once had are steadily eroded, making it hard for them to regain their school momentum when school resumes.

The causes of learning loss are multi-dimensional. A significant reason for this is that they lack a practice that takes place, as no engagement can be learnt during breaks among students. In this situation, learning is never consistent. Moreover, there is socioeconomic disparity, where children from low-income families don’t have books, internet connectivity, or tutors from a family background, which exaggerates the impact of learning loss.

Some subjects are more prone to learning loss than others. For example, mathematics is vulnerable because it requires cumulative learning and constant practice. Reading and writing skills also deteriorate because there are few reading materials and opportunities to develop written expression. Over time, these losses can be significant academic setbacks.

Learning loss’s reverberations are not just temporary trouble in academic scores. It opens and expands achievement gaps between students from various socio-economic backgrounds and causes long-term problems, such as a lack of readiness for college or career advancement.

Challenges And Limitations:

Although online tutoring has many benefits, it has challenges and limitations. One major issue is the digital divide, which translates into students not having equal internet access or devices they can use. Many students from poor backgrounds cannot benefit from online learning due to lack of access.

There is also a problem of not seeing people in person, so it may be difficult for the tutor to identify non-verbal cues such as confusion or disengagement. Some students can also get unmotivated to learn in virtual environments, resulting in low engagement and effectiveness.

Tutoring may also vary widely in quality because the sites have improper regulations. Some even higher tutors have the wrong qualifications and experience, which affects the quality of education. In addition, some technical faults, such as software or connectivity, often disturb learning and frustrate students and parents.

Lastly, there is screen fatigue. Prolonged exposure to screens causes distractions in concentration and discomfort. Therefore, balancing screen time and effective learning poses a critical challenge in online tutoring.
